An education from Kaplan College can allow you to specialize in front or back office duties, or diversify and do both. Duties may include:
- Interviewing patients
- Charting histories
- Taking vital signs
- Assisting during exams, minor surgeries, and lab procedures
- Assisting with receptionist duties

Potential Career Opportunities
With a diploma from our medical assistant program you can seek entry-level positions including:
- Back office lab aide
- Billing/collections clerk
- Blood bank donor unit assistant
- Blood/plasma lab aide
- Clinical lab aide (venipuncture)
- Front office assistant manager
- Hospital donor unit assistant
- Medical assistant
- Medical office assistant manager
- Personnel records clerk
- School health aide
